คำถามที่พบบ่อย: นามแฝงทำงานอย่างไรใน Linux?

จุดประสงค์ของคำสั่ง alias คืออะไร?

นามแฝง ให้คุณสร้างชื่อช็อตคัทสำหรับคำสั่ง ชื่อไฟล์ หรือเชลล์ข้อความ. การใช้นามแฝงช่วยประหยัดเวลาได้มากเมื่อทำงานที่คุณทำบ่อยๆ คุณสามารถสร้างนามแฝงคำสั่ง

เหตุใดนามแฝงจึงมีประโยชน์ใน Linux

คำสั่งนามแฝง อนุญาตให้ผู้ใช้เรียกใช้คำสั่งหรือกลุ่มคำสั่งใด ๆ (รวมถึงตัวเลือกและชื่อไฟล์) โดยการป้อนคำเดียว. … ใช้คำสั่ง alias เพื่อแสดงรายการของนามแฝงที่กำหนดไว้ทั้งหมด คุณสามารถเพิ่มนามแฝงที่ผู้ใช้กำหนดเองใน ~/

จะสร้างนามแฝงได้อย่างไร?

การประกาศนามแฝงเริ่มต้นด้วย คีย์เวิร์ดนามแฝง ตามด้วยชื่อนามแฝง เครื่องหมายเท่ากับ และคำสั่งที่คุณต้องการเรียกใช้เมื่อคุณพิมพ์นามแฝง คำสั่งต้องอยู่ในเครื่องหมายคำพูดและไม่มีช่องว่างรอบเครื่องหมายเท่ากับ ต้องประกาศนามแฝงแต่ละรายการในบรรทัดใหม่

สร้างไฟล์นามแฝงใน Linux ได้อย่างไร?

ขั้นตอนในการสร้างนามแฝง Bash ถาวร:

  1. แก้ไข ~/. bash_aliases หรือ ~/. bashrc โดยใช้: vi ~/. bash_aliases
  2. ต่อท้าย bash alias ของคุณ
  3. ตัวอย่างเช่น ผนวก: alias update='sudo yum update'
  4. บันทึกและปิดไฟล์
  5. เปิดใช้งานนามแฝงโดยพิมพ์: source ~/. bash_aliases

คุณใช้นามแฝงอย่างไร?

ไวยากรณ์นามแฝง

ไวยากรณ์สำหรับการสร้างนามแฝงนั้นง่าย คุณ พิมพ์คำว่า "นามแฝง" ตามด้วยชื่อที่คุณต้องการให้นามแฝงให้ใส่เครื่องหมาย = แล้วเพิ่มคำสั่งที่คุณต้องการให้เรียกใช้ โดยทั่วไปจะอยู่ในเครื่องหมายคำพูดเดี่ยวหรือคู่ คำสั่งคำเดียว เช่น “alias c=clear” ไม่ต้องใช้เครื่องหมายคำพูด

คำสั่ง alias ทำงานอย่างไร

นามแฝงคือชื่อ (โดยปกติจะสั้น) ที่เชลล์แปลเป็นชื่อหรือคำสั่งอื่น (มักจะยาวกว่า) นามแฝง อนุญาตให้คุณกำหนดคำสั่งใหม่โดยแทนที่สตริงสำหรับโทเค็นแรกของคำสั่งง่าย ๆ. โดยทั่วไปจะอยู่ใน ~/. bashrc (ทุบตี) หรือ ~/.

ฉันจะแสดงรายการนามแฝงได้อย่างไร

หากต้องการดูรายชื่อนามแฝงที่ตั้งค่าบนกล่อง linux ของคุณ เพียงพิมพ์นามแฝงที่พรอมต์. คุณจะเห็นว่ามีการตั้งค่าบางอย่างในการติดตั้ง Redhat 9 ที่เป็นค่าเริ่มต้นอยู่แล้ว หากต้องการลบนามแฝง ให้ใช้คำสั่ง unalias

คำสั่งแบบเต็มสำหรับนามแฝง PWD คืออะไร

การดำเนินการ Multics มีคำสั่ง pwd (ซึ่งเป็นชื่อย่อของ คำสั่ง print_wdir) ซึ่งเป็นที่มาของคำสั่ง Unix pwd คำสั่งคือเชลล์ที่มีอยู่แล้วในเชลล์ Unix ส่วนใหญ่ เช่น Bourne shell, ash, bash, ksh และ zsh สามารถใช้งานได้ง่ายด้วยฟังก์ชัน POSIX C getcwd() หรือ getwd()

นามแฝงเหมือนกับทางลัดหรือไม่

(1) ชื่ออื่นที่ใช้สำหรับระบุตัวตน เช่น สำหรับการตั้งชื่อฟิลด์หรือไฟล์ ดูระเบียน CNAME และชื่อแทนอีเมล … Mac เทียบเท่ากับ "ทางลัด" ของ Windows นามแฝงสามารถวางบนเดสก์ท็อปหรือเก็บไว้ในโฟลเดอร์อื่นและ การคลิกนามแฝงจะเหมือนกับการคลิกไอคอนของไฟล์ต้นฉบับ.

ฉันจะสร้างนามแฝงใน Unix ได้อย่างไร

ในการสร้างนามแฝงใน bash ที่ตั้งค่าทุกครั้งที่คุณเริ่มเชลล์:

  1. เปิด ~/. ไฟล์ bash_profile
  2. เพิ่มบรรทัดที่มีนามแฝง—เช่น alias lf='ls -F'
  3. บันทึกไฟล์
  4. ออกจากบรรณาธิการ นามแฝงใหม่จะถูกตั้งค่าสำหรับเชลล์ตัวถัดไปที่คุณเริ่ม
  5. เปิดหน้าต่าง Terminal ใหม่เพื่อตรวจสอบว่ามีการตั้งค่านามแฝง: นามแฝง

ข้อใดใช้สร้างนามแฝง

หมายเหตุ ดิ คีย์เวิร์ด PUBLIC ใช้เพื่อสร้างนามแฝงสาธารณะ (หรือที่เรียกว่าคำพ้องความหมายสาธารณะ) หากไม่ได้ใช้คีย์เวิร์ด PUBLIC ประเภทของนามแฝงจะเป็นนามแฝงส่วนตัว (หรือเรียกอีกอย่างว่าพ้องส่วนตัว) นามแฝงสาธารณะสามารถใช้ได้เฉพาะในคำสั่ง SQL และกับยูทิลิตี้ LOAD

ชอบโพสต์นี้? กรุณาแบ่งปันให้เพื่อนของคุณ:
ระบบปฏิบัติการวันนี้